Opublikowano: 5 czerwca 2024
Liczba godzin tygodniowo: 40
Numer roli: 200554321
Zespół AIML Information Intelligence w Apple jest pionierem w dziedzinie nowych technologii z zakresu sztucznej inteligencji, uczenia maszynowego oraz przetwarzania języka naturalnego. Nasza uniwersalna wyszukiwarka poprawia możliwości wyszukiwania w różnych produktach Apple, takich jak Siri, Spotlight, Safari, Wiadomości i Lookup. Jesteśmy również na czele rozwijania zaawansowanych technologii AI generatywnego, wykorzystujących duże modele językowe (LLMs) do wzmacniania urządzeń Apple i usług w chmurze.
Jako członek tej dynamicznej grupy, będziesz przyczyniał się do inicjatyw uczenia maszynowego i głębokiego uczenia na dużą skalę, mających na celu ulepszenie Otwartego Domenowego Systemu Odpowiadania na Pytania. Twoje zadania będą obejmowały:
- Analizowanie wymagań, problemów i możliwości dotyczących rankingu i trafności wyszukiwania
- Rozwijanie, dopracowywanie i ocenianie specyficznych dla domeny dużych modeli językowych dla różnych zadań i aplikacji w produktach Apple zasilanych przez AI
- Przeprowadzanie stosowanej generatywnej badań AI, aby przekształcić nowoczesne rozwójowe technologie w technologie gotowe do produkcji
- Przekładanie wymagań produktów na zadania modelowania i inżynieryjne
- Budowanie modeli uczenia maszynowego dla odpowiedzi na pytania, trafności wyszukiwania, rankingu i rozumienia zapytań
- Integracja funkcji wyszukiwania z produktami Apple, takimi jak Siri, Spotlight, Safari, Wiadomości i Lookup
- Rozwijanie systemów produkcyjnych end-to-end dla rozumienia zapytań i rankingu, by poprawić wyszukiwanie i otwarte domeny odpowiadające na pytania
- Korzystanie ze Sparka, Hadoop MapReduce, Hive oraz Impali do rozproszonego przetwarzania danych
- Doświadczenie w uczeniu maszynowym, głębokim uczeniu/LLM, odzyskiwaniu informacji i przetwarzaniu języka naturalnego
- Doświadczenie z inżynierią promptów, dopracowywaniem, oceną i rozwijaniem narzędzi do zbierania danych/adnotacji/zarządzania dla LLM
- Znajomość Pythona i co najmniej jednego z następujących języków: Go, Java lub C++
- Doskonała wiedza i praktyczne umiejętności w głównych algorytmach uczenia maszynowego
- Silne umiejętności analityczne danych
- Dobre umiejętności interpersonalne i postawa zespołowa
- Doświadczenie z Data-Miningiem na dużą skalę i uczeniem maszynowym będzie dodatkowym atutem
- Doświadczenie z optymalizacją inferencji modeli ML i LLM będzie miało znaczenie
W Apple, wynagrodzenie bazowe jest jednym z aspektów naszego kompleksowego pakietu wynagrodzeń i jest ustalane